Lead was widely used in paints and coatings because of its durability, corrosion resistance, flexibility and moisture resistance. It may be present in decorative paints, primers, anti-corrosion coatings, industrial coatings, metal finishes, varnishes and lacquers. As lead cannot be identified reliably by visual inspection, sampling and laboratory analysis are the principal elements of a lead paint survey.
Core Surveys carry out lead paint surveys to identify whether painted surfaces within an agreed survey scope contain lead and, where present, determine the concentration. Samples are taken from representative painted elements and analysed by a third-party laboratory. The results are used to provide a Lead Content Assessment and, where appropriate, a Priority Assessment, helping clients understand where lead-containing paints are present and how they should be managed.

How our Lead Paint Surveys work
Our surveyors use a representative sampling strategy based on the size, age and complexity of the building and the range of painted finishes present. Samples may be taken from walls, ceilings, doors, skirting boards, windows and other painted elements, including visually different paint types, finishes or colours.
Samples are normally collected through the full depth of the paint system to the substrate, so that historic paint layers are included within the laboratory analysis. Where paint is damaged, flaking or delaminating, additional sampling may be undertaken to assess the affected coating separately. The laboratory results are reported in parts per million (ppm) and categorised according to lead content.

Core Surveys’ approach is informed by the Health and Safety Executive’s Control of Lead at Work (L132), the Approved Code of Practice and guidance supporting the Control of Lead at Work Regulations 2002. L132 provides practical guidance on managing risks from lead at work. It is particularly relevant where maintenance, refurbishment, demolition or other activities may disturb lead-containing paint.

Lead Paint Risk Assessment & Management
Identifying lead in paint is only part of the assessment. Our reports consider the lead concentration alongside the condition of the paint, the likelihood of disturbance, normal occupant and maintenance activity, accessibility and potential for human exposure.
The findings are used to produce a Priority Assessment to help identify which painted surfaces may require greater management attention. Recommendations may include managing the paint in situ, repairing or encapsulating damaged coatings, or removal where the risks or proposed works warrant it. The findings should be considered alongside the building’s intended use, planned maintenance or refurbishment and suitable site-specific risk assessments.
What is a lead paint survey?
A lead paint survey involves inspecting painted surfaces within an agreed scope and taking representative samples for laboratory analysis. The purpose is to establish whether lead is present in the paint and, where it is present, determine the concentration. The findings can then be used to assess priorities and inform appropriate management measures.
Can lead paint be identified by visual inspection?
No. Lead cannot be identified by visual inspection. Sampling is therefore a principal part of a lead paint survey. Paint samples are normally collected through the full depth of the coating system so that historic paint layers can be included in the laboratory analysis.
Where can lead be found?
Lead may be present in a range of decorative and protective coatings, including decorative paints, primers, anti-corrosion coatings, industrial coatings, metal coatings and finishes, varnishes and lacquers.
How are lead paint samples taken?
Samples are normally collected through the full depth of the paint system to the underlying substrate. The surveyor records details such as the sample location, paint type, substrate and visible paint colours. It should be noted that where coatings are very thin, particularly in the case of varnishes and stains, the sample area may need to be the equivalent size of two to three credit cards in order that a sufficient size sample is collected for analysis. Smaller areas will be required where there are multiple layers of thicker paint.
How are lead paint samples analysed?
Paint samples are analysed by a third-party laboratory. Paint samples are digested in aqua-regia using a hot-block. Metals are then determined in the digest by inductively coupled plasma optical emission spectrophotometry (ICP-OES). Laboratory certificates are included within the survey report.
What does the lead content result mean?
Laboratory results are reported in parts per million (ppm) and categorised into seven lead content ratings, ranging from Low to Extremely High. The result helps establish the concentration of lead present but should be considered alongside the condition of the paint and the likelihood of disturbance when assessing risk.
Does finding lead paint mean that it has to be removed?
No. The appropriate management approach depends on factors including the lead concentration, condition of the paint, likelihood of disturbance, accessibility and potential for human exposure. Depending on the circumstances, recommendations may include managing the paint in situ, repairing or encapsulating it, or removal. If there is planned refurbishment then rigorous risk assessment may be required.
What is a Priority Assessment?
A Priority Assessment considers the condition of lead-containing paint together with factors such as normal occupant and maintenance activity, likelihood of disturbance and potential for human exposure. It is intended to help identify painted surfaces that may require greater management attention and should form part of a wider, site-specific risk assessment.
What happens if lead paint is found?
The findings should be communicated to relevant employees, contractors and others who may undertake work that could disturb the painted surfaces. Depending on the circumstances, management measures may include maintaining a register, monitoring the condition of the paint, repairing or encapsulating damaged areas, and ensuring suitable risk assessments and safe systems of work are in place before work is undertaken.
Can you survey areas that are difficult to access?
The survey scope and access arrangements are agreed in advance. Standard access equipment may be used where appropriate, while areas requiring specialist equipment such as MEWPs or scaffolding will only be inspected where suitable arrangements have been agreed. Concealed or inaccessible spaces are not included unless specifically incorporated into the survey scope.
Can lead paint surveys be carried out before refurbishment or demolition?
Yes. The survey findings should be consulted before maintenance, refurbishment, demolition or installation work that could disturb painted surfaces. The survey is intended to identify and assess lead-containing paints within the agreed scope; it is not a specification or scope of works for lead paint removal or remediation.
Is there a safe level of lead exposure?
No. There is no safe level of lead exposure. Where work may disturb lead-containing paint, appropriate risk assessments, control measures and safe systems of work must be implemented.
